Asset information for asset ID #1632664

Asset Basics:

Extended info:

    768px
    1,024px
    No
    157,479

Asset Origins:

Times Cited Origin Cited
1 Google and stuff

Asset usage:

title views votes rating creation usage
?(nsfw) Onyxia Is Still Serious Business...And A Little... 5,075 15 (2.87)  2006-12-06 Foreground